Subject: Handover — soft deletes on orders

Taking over from tonight's shift. Summary: soft deletes in the orders table on Merchantry are not propagating to the reporting replica. About 1,200 rows affected since Tuesday. Backfill script is staged but not run; needs release-manager sign-off before the Thursday deploy. No customer impact yet. Questions on the backfill plan should go to the address below.

escalation mailbox, hadug-bajog: sormir@norvalabs.internal

**Vendor note: Inkmill markdown pipeline**

Rendering for Parchway docs is outsourced to Inkmill under an annual contract, renewing each March. They handle sanitization and PDF export; we own the upload queue. SLA: 4-hour response on rendering failures. Escalate only after two failed retries. Their support desk is reachable at the address below.

billing contact of hahaf-baguf = zorael.tammir.jorius@sivrelhq.internal

So, we finally turned on websocket compression for the Fenwick live-quotes feed, and the tradeoffs are real. Full-window deflate saved ~60% bandwidth but chewed CPU and added latency jitter on small frames, which the charts team noticed immediately. This PR lands a middle path: compress only frames above a size floor, use a modest window, and reuse contexts per connection instead of per message. Future maintainers, please benchmark before touching these — the sweet spot was narrow. Current settings below.

tuning table, yajog-yahof:
BUDGETS = {
    "lamvan": 303,
    "wenox": 460,
    "fenvan": 525,
}